인공지능 공부
docker runtime nvidia 문제 해결하기
DualQuaternion
2023. 7. 20. 15:50
현재 아래 메세지를 실행하면
docker run \
--runtime=nvidia \
-ti --rm \
--network host \
--gpus all \
--env="DISPLAY" \
--env="QT_X11_NO_MITSHM=1" \
--volume="/tmp/.X11-unix:/tmp/.X11-unix:rw" \
--volume="$HOME/.Xauthority:/home/.Xauthority:rw" \
--volume="${PWD}:/home/MC-Calib" \
--volume="PATH_TO_DATA:/home/MC-Calib/data" \
bailool/mc-calib-prod
docker: Error response from daemon: Unknown runtime specified nvidia.
이런 에러가 난다.
어떻게 해결해야 할까?...
일단 기존에 설치한 도커를 지웠다... nvidia 도커를 설치해야 하므로.,,,
https://biology-statistics-programming.tistory.com/136
요거 보고 지움...
이제 설치를 해보자. 아래꺼 보고 따라함
https://velog.io/@boom109/Nvidia-docker
마지막에 테스트하는 부분만
sudo docker run --rm --gpus all nvidia/cuda:11.0-base nvidia-smi
로 수정해서 진행했다. 결과는 성공!! 이제 남은 작업을 다시 진행하자.